Read moreTOAST! is the stage play version of Nigel Slater’s award winning autobiography. Brought vividly to life by a very talented cast of five. We are taken back to relive Nigel’s childhood starting in the heart of the home – the kitchen. We see events through Nigel’s eyes and through the sights sounds smells and tastes he remembers.
